Ashok Tanwar’s Shocking Return to Congress Disrupts BJP Just Before Haryana Elections

In a dramatic political turn of events, former Lok Sabha MP Ashok Tanwar has rejoined Congress just days before the Haryana Assembly elections. Tanwar, a prominent Dalit leader and former Haryana Congress chief, made his return to the party official on October 3, 2024, during a rally in Mahendragarh, where he was seen alongside Rahul Gandhi. This move comes as a significant boost for Congress, which is looking to unseat the ruling BJP in the upcoming state elections​.

A Rollercoaster Political Journey

Ashok Tanwar’s political journey over the past five years has been nothing short of tumultuous. Tanwar, who served as Congress MP from Sirsa in 2009 and later as Haryana Congress president from 2014 to 2019, resigned from the party in 2019 due to differences with senior Congress leader Bhupinder Singh Hooda. Following his exit, Tanwar launched his own political outfit, the Apna Bharat Morcha, in 2021. However, he quickly shifted his allegiance to the Trinamool Congress (TMC) later that year, and then to the Aam Aadmi Party (AAP) in 2022. His most recent switch occurred earlier this year when he joined the Bharatiya Janata Party (BJP)​.

His latest re-entry into Congress marks his fourth political switch in just five years, a move that underscores his complex relationship with various political parties. Tanwar’s return to Congress has surprised many, particularly as he was recently seen campaigning for the BJP in the lead-up to the Haryana Assembly elections​.

Impact on Haryana’s Political Landscape

Tanwar’s return to Congress could have a significant impact on the political landscape of Haryana, especially as the state gears up for its elections on October 5, 2024. Known for his grassroots connections and influence among the Dalit community, Tanwar is expected to provide Congress with an electoral boost in key constituencies. His rejoining also poses a setback for the BJP, which had counted on his support to consolidate votes in its favor​.

The timing of Tanwar’s move is crucial, as it comes just before the final days of election campaigning. Political analysts believe that his re-entry into Congress could sway a segment of voters who were undecided or leaning towards the BJP, especially in regions like Sirsa and Mahendragarh​.

Rahul Gandhi’s Influence

Tanwar’s rejoining of Congress has been largely attributed to his long-standing association with Rahul Gandhi. The two have shared a close political relationship, dating back to when Tanwar served as president of the Indian Youth Congress. Tanwar was seen as one of Gandhi’s trusted aides during his tenure with the Congress, and his fallout in 2019 was considered a major loss for Gandhi’s camp​.

Rahul Gandhi, during the rally in Mahendragarh where Tanwar’s return was announced, emphasized Congress’s commitment to unity and its focus on restoring constitutional values, themes that resonate with Tanwar’s political ethos. Gandhi’s ‘Bharat Jodo Yatra,’ which seeks to unite the country across political and social lines, seems to have been a key factor in convincing Tanwar to return to the Congress fold​.

A Setback for BJP

Tanwar’s defection from the BJP is seen as a major blow to the party, particularly since he was actively campaigning for the saffron brigade in Haryana just days before his switch. His departure from the BJP adds to the party’s existing challenges in the state, where it faces anti-incumbency sentiments and a strong opposition alliance between Congress and other regional players​.

The BJP had hoped that Tanwar, with his influence in the Dalit community, would help it secure key votes in the upcoming elections. However, with his re-entry into Congress, the party is now left scrambling to recalibrate its electoral strategy in the final days of the campaign​.
